Forestville: David C. Earle, 86, of Straight Road, Forestville died Saturday, April 12, 2025 at his residence, following a lengthy illness. He was born in Perrysburg on May 15, 1938, the son of the late David K. and Dorotha (Potter) Earle.
David was a graduate of Forestville Central School, Class of 1956 and received his Bachelors and Masters degrees from Fredonia State University. He worked as an Instrumental Music Teacher for West Seneca Central Schools for 33 years, was a Proprietor of the Hamburg Model Railroad Station and a Choir Director.
David was a Man of God and a Servant of God. He was a wonderful husband, father and grandfather who enjoyed teaching instrumental music to children and loved to travel. David was a Master of Model Railroading and a Professional Antique Furniture Restorer. As an advocate and champion for individuals with Developmental Disabilities, he helped start several Group Homes. "He accomplished his mission."
Survivors include his wife of 58 years, Susan (McDuffee) Earle of Forestville, whom he married on December 23, 1966 in the East Leon Wesleyan Church, and a son Nathan (Lisa) Earle, of West Seneca. Also surviving are six grandchildren; Evan & Ellie Earle, Madeline Kandefer and Olivia, Emily & Ethan Dearlove, nephews Andrus & Earle Houck, along with four nieces, two other nephews and many great nieces & nephews. Besides his parents he was predeceased by a son, Jeremy David Earle, who died December 18, 2012 and a sister Barbara Houck, who died in 2013.
There will be a Private Celebration of Life held. In lieu of flowers, memorial contributions may be made either to Chautauqua Hospice & Palliative Care, 20 W. Fairmount Avenue, Lakewood, NY 14750, or Love In the Name of Christ (Love INC), 15 West Main Street, Gowanda, NY 14070.
